With its mellow, almost buttery flavor and texture, roasted garlic is a surefire way to perk up low-fat dishes.


Roasted Garlic Recipe

Preparation

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F. Rub off excess papery skin from the garlic head without separating the cloves. Slice about 1/2 inch off the top of the garlic head. Place the garlic on a square of aluminum foil or in a ceramic garlic roaster, if you have one. Sprinkle with 2 teaspoons water and pinch the edges of the foil together to make a package.
  2. Roast until the cloves are very soft, 40 to 45 minutes. Unwrap and let cool slightly. Squeeze the cloves out of the skins.
